Cities in Cabell County, West Virginia by Population (2024)

There are 11 cities in Cabell County, West Virginia.

Note: As defined by the US Census Bureau, a city's official boundaries often extend miles beyond the city itself and may even cross county lines. As such, several thousand US cities officially exist in two or more counties (and therefore appear on multiple counties' lists of cities.)

What is the largest city in Cabell County, West Virginia?

Huntington is the largest city in Cabell County.

What is the smallest city in Cabell County, West Virginia?

Salt Rock is the smallest city in Cabell County.
